Know the Signs of Problem Gambling

  • Spending more money or time on gambling than intended
  • Chasing losses in an attempt to recover money
  • Feeling anxious, depressed, or irritable when not gambling
  • Neglecting work, studies, or family responsibilities
  • Borrowing or stealing to fund gambling
  • Hiding your gambling activity from others

Tips to Stay in Control

  • Set a clear budget and stick to it
  • Use session time limits and take regular breaks
  • Never gamble with money you can’t afford to lose
  • Don’t treat gambling as a way to make money
  • Avoid gambling when you’re stressed or under the influence
  • Use demo games to explore slots risk-free

Self-Exclusion and Blocking Tools

If you want to take a break or stop gambling altogether, many online casinos offer:

  • Self-exclusion options (temporary or permanent)
  • Deposit, wager, or loss limits
  • Session time reminders

Help & Support Services in South Africa

If you or someone you care about needs help, reach out to these organisations:

  • NRGP (National Responsible Gambling Programme)

    Helpline: 0800 006 008 (24/7 toll-free)

    Website: responsiblegambling.org.za

  • SADAG (South African Depression and Anxiety Group)

    Website: sadag.org

    WhatsApp: 087 163 2030
